we used to but stopped because it was too inconvenient. i had one day per week reserved for me and every week, on my day, i had to drive 30min to the farm to pick up my milk. if we ran out, i had to wait until my day or buy regular milk at the grocery store. and i had to take a set amount each week, even if i didn't need it all.
i liked that it was not processed in way, truly natural. i just believe that the less we do, the better. i assume that it is healthier.
dh loved the taste. he is extremely particular about the taste of milk. he doesn't like the taste of any of the brands found in grocery stores. he says it is no wonder so many people don't like milk, the milk isn't real milk. dh grew up on raw milk, straight from the cow.
i would go back to raw milk if i could get it more conveniently.
